Talking jerk turkey wings & chipotles

yesterday i smoked a couple jerk rubbed turkey wings with cherry and then smoked some red jalapenos with jack daniels oak barrel chips.





i pulled all the jalapeno plants and here is what was on the vines







those are in the dehydrator now
